Megan Baker: Interview

How did you first get into photography?

I first got into photography around age 3/4. I picked up the family polaroid and started taking pictures of my toys. I wasn’t actually serious about what I was doing until around 9. Eventually I started doing weddings and concerts at age 12, and I started the kind of art work I’m doing now at age 14.

How would you describe your style?

I think it’s a blend of a lot of things. I think when you first see it, you’d notice it’s very digital, and very edited, but it also has a classic feel, and a warmth. A lot of people will tell me they notice my photos are very dark, yet have a sense of hope to them. Like there is a storm in this photo now, but it’ll be sunny again, and maybe, just maybe, the people who lived there will come back.

Megan Baker: Interview

What do you look for in a composition?

Very hard to describe. I know what it is, but can’t exactly put it into words. How the grass is... the Midwest, in the winter and spring, how some of the trees are, and the fields.. there’s something about them, magical in a way. If there’s just a house sitting some place with some other houses around it, right now, for me, it’s not going to do. I need to feel it. I want to see the dead grass blow in the breeze. I want to see vines ascending up buildings or trees... I think that a natural or organic aspect is very important in my photographs. I want to be able to think back on that moment and be able feel how I felt when I was taking it. I want other people to feel that.
